русс | укр

Языки программирования

ПаскальСиАссемблерJavaMatlabPhpHtmlJavaScriptCSSC#DelphiТурбо Пролог

Компьютерные сетиСистемное программное обеспечениеИнформационные технологииПрограммирование

Все о программировании


Linux Unix Алгоритмические языки Аналоговые и гибридные вычислительные устройства Архитектура микроконтроллеров Введение в разработку распределенных информационных систем Введение в численные методы Дискретная математика Информационное обслуживание пользователей Информация и моделирование в управлении производством Компьютерная графика Математическое и компьютерное моделирование Моделирование Нейрокомпьютеры Проектирование программ диагностики компьютерных систем и сетей Проектирование системных программ Системы счисления Теория статистики Теория оптимизации Уроки AutoCAD 3D Уроки базы данных Access Уроки Orcad Цифровые автоматы Шпаргалки по компьютеру Шпаргалки по программированию Экспертные системы Элементы теории информации

Пакетами.


Дата добавления: 2013-12-24; просмотров: 704; Нарушение авторских прав


Том) по одному и тому же каналу;

Обратном направлении пакета с подтверждающим ответом;

Таким образом, введение замедления при возрастании числа столкновений является своеобразной формой управления перегрузками в локальной сети.

По методу двоичного экспоненциального алгоритма замедления интервал ожидания повторной посылки равен:

Тож = 2nRK. (3.3)

Для этого метода характерно, что даже при возрастании числа запросов на передачу производительность системы не снижается, поэтому он нашел применение практически во всех локальных сетях, реализующих МДКН/ОС. МДКН/ОС на практике оказался очень эффективным, при нем коэффициент использования тракта передачи достигает более 90 %. В локальных сетях, реализующих этот метод, не требуется специальных подтверждений приема отдельных пакетов для информирования отправителя о том, что посланный пакет не был искажен при передаче. Однако на практике имеют место различные недостатки. случаи разрушения пакетов по различным причинам, например из-за помех. Кроме того, может оказаться, что емкость буфера недостаточна для приема пакетов, в результате чего. Другими словами, процедуры распределения каналов и приема пакетов не всегда удачно согласованы.

Для устранения таких недостатков как разрушение пакетов из-за помех и недостаточных размеров буфера, в результате чего даже при отсутствии столкновений посланные пакеты не могут использоваться абонентом, несмотря на то, что они до него дошли, была разработана система с подтверждением, обеспечивающая следующие возможности:

• с приемом каждого информационного пакета осуществляется посылка в

• пересылка обоих пакетов (информационного и с подтверждающим отве-

• отсутствие столкновения пакета с подтверждающим ответом с другими

 

Рис. 61. Временная диаграмма МДКС/ОС с подтверждением



 

Узел такой системы, имеющий запросы на передачу, посылает пакеты только при возможности неоднократного использования канала после получения подтверждения о том, что он свободен, и по истечении определенной паузы, называемой основным временем ожидания (рис. 61). Время ожидания определяется как сумма времени распространения сигнала в передающей среде в прямом и обратном направлениях и времени задержки от момента окончания приема информационного пакета до начала передачи пакета с подтверждающим ответом. Узел, принявший информационный пакет, старается как можно быстрее отослать подтверждение. Пакет с подтверждающим ответом всегда имеет приоритет перед информационным пакетом. В течение основного времени ожидания передающий узел либо принимает пакеты с подтверждением, либо ждет окончания основного времени ожидания прежде, чем принять решение о необходимости повторной посылки искаженного пакета.

Принцип работы систем с подтверждением основывается, как правило, на методах МДКН и МДКН/ОС. Примерами таких систем являются OMNINET и Acknowledging Ethernet.



<== предыдущая лекция | следующая лекция ==>
Здесь частоту столкновений п можно рассматривать как один из критериев, характеризующих количество запросов на передачу. | Основные понятия и определения математического программирования


Карта сайта Карта сайта укр


Уроки php mysql Программирование

Онлайн система счисления Калькулятор онлайн обычный Инженерный калькулятор онлайн Замена русских букв на английские для вебмастеров Замена русских букв на английские

Аппаратное и программное обеспечение Графика и компьютерная сфера Интегрированная геоинформационная система Интернет Компьютер Комплектующие компьютера Лекции Методы и средства измерений неэлектрических величин Обслуживание компьютерных и периферийных устройств Операционные системы Параллельное программирование Проектирование электронных средств Периферийные устройства Полезные ресурсы для программистов Программы для программистов Статьи для программистов Cтруктура и организация данных


 


Не нашли то, что искали? Google вам в помощь!

 
 

© life-prog.ru При использовании материалов прямая ссылка на сайт обязательна.

Генерация страницы за: 0.005 сек.